Laparoscopic Device Market Poised for Steady Growth to USD 20.5 Billion by 2034, Driven by Minimally Invasive Surgeries and Obesity Prevalence
The global laparoscopic device market, valued at an estimated USD 13.59 billion in 2024, is on a trajectory for consistent expansion, projected to reach USD 20.5 billion by 2034. This growth, forecasted at a compound annual growth rate (CAGR) of 4.2% from 2024 to 2034, is significantly propelled by the escalating prevalence of obesity across diverse age demographics and the increasing adoption of minimally invasive surgical techniques worldwide. Driving Factors for Market Expansion
Laparoscopic treatments have firmly established themselves as the preferred surgical approach for numerous procedures, primarily due to their inherent advantages over traditional open surgeries. These benefits include smaller incisions, reduced post-operative discomfort, shorter hospital stays, and significantly quicker recovery times for patients. The rising incidence of conditions such as obesity, various gastrointestinal issues, and different forms of cancer continues to fuel the demand for laparoscopic surgeries. Furthermore, substantial investments by both governments and the private healthcare sector in advanced healthcare infrastructure and technologies, including sophisticated laparoscopic equipment, are enhancing patient outcomes and contributing to lower healthcare costs associated with prolonged hospitalizations and post-operative complications.
Historical Performance and Future Outlook
While the historical CAGR for the laparoscopic device market stood at a robust 5.3%, the forecasted CAGR of 4.2% indicates a slight moderation in the growth rate through 2034. This anticipated decline can be attributed to several factors, including the potential for market saturation in certain regions or segments as the adoption of laparoscopic devices becomes more widespread. Additionally, economic downturns or uncertainties in key markets can impact healthcare spending and investment in medical equipment, leading to slower growth compared to previous years. Nevertheless, the market continues to benefit from rising disposable incomes, improvements in global healthcare infrastructure, and a growing public awareness of the benefits of less invasive surgical procedures. There is also a heightened emphasis on enhancing the safety and efficacy of laparoscopic procedures within the framework of value-based healthcare.
Key Threats and Challenges
However, the market faces several key threats that could impede its growth. Rapid advancements in technology, particularly the emergence of robotic-assisted surgery and other alternative minimally invasive techniques, pose a significant challenge to the demand for traditional laparoscopic devices. Intense competition among key players often leads to pricing pressures, which can erode profit margins and create difficulties in retaining market share. Furthermore, reductions in reimbursement rates or restrictions on coverage for laparoscopic surgeries may deter healthcare providers from investing in new laparoscopic devices, thereby affecting overall market growth. High-profile product recalls or safety warnings also carry the risk of defaming reputable manufacturers and discouraging future adoption of their devices.
Country-wise Market Insights
Geographically, India is poised to lead the market, driven by its robust medical tourism industry that offers cost-effective yet high-quality healthcare services. India attracts a substantial number of international patients seeking minimally invasive surgical procedures utilizing laparoscopic devices, with a projected CAGR of 6.2% from 2024 to 2034. The United States market, with a forecast CAGR of 2.6%, is primarily driven by the widespread adoption of minimally invasive surgical procedures across specialties like gynecology, urology, general surgery, and bariatric surgery, including common procedures such as laparoscopic cholecystectomy and appendectomy. Canada's market, expected to grow at a 4% CAGR, sees extensive utilization of laparoscopic devices across a wide range of surgical specialties, including hernia repair and prostatectomy. France, with a 3% CAGR, demonstrates particular proficiency in laparoscopic gynecological surgery, with a large percentage of equipment used for treatments like hysterectomy and myomectomy. Thailand's market, boasting a 5.8% CAGR, is significantly boosted by its popularity as a medical tourism destination for laparoscopic and other minimally invasive surgical treatments.

Segment-wise Market Dominance
In terms of product type, direct energy system devices are set to maintain a significant share, accounting for 28.5% of the market in 2024. These devices are crucial in minimally invasive surgeries, offering surgeons precise control over effective tissue sealing and cutting capabilities. Their market domination is highly boosted by continuous technological developments and increasing usage in medical facilities. Concurrently, the bariatric surgery segment is anticipated to hold a dominant share in the application category, representing 28% of the market in 2024. This reflects the surging demand for laparoscopic procedures to address obesity-related health concerns. Bariatric surgeries, such as gastric bypass and sleeve gastrectomy, extensively utilize laparoscopic techniques to reduce stomach size and promote weight loss. With rising global obesity rates and growing awareness of minimally invasive approaches, the bariatric surgery segment is expected to continue its strong growth trajectory.
Competitive Landscape and Key Developments
The competitive landscape of the laparoscopic device market is dynamic, with innovative companies and startups increasingly disrupting traditional players. These new entrants are leveraging advancements in robotics, artificial intelligence, and miniaturization to develop cutting-edge laparoscopic devices that promise improved precision, efficiency, and patient outcomes. Many startups focus on niche segments or specialize in specific aspects of laparoscopic surgery, such as advanced imaging systems, energy devices, or surgical robotics. Notable recent developments include Asensus Surgical, Inc.'s Memorandum of Understanding with KARL STORZ VentureONE Pte. Ltd. in February 2023, focusing on endoscopes and laparoscopic vision systems. Additionally, in January 2022, Seger Surgical Solutions introduced the LAP IA 60 device for intracorporeal anastomosis, offering a secure and rapid solution for efficiently aligning, sealing, and stapling anastomosis openings without the need for internal fixation.
